Communication settings

Ethernet ports

The protection relay allows the use of a secondary IP address for the station ports on
the communication modules COM1001...COM1003. This secondary IP network is
assigned to a single Ethernet port and can be used to make separate networks for
different communication protocols or, for example, a separate service network for
configuration purposes. Multicast station/bus communication, such as IEC 61850-9-2
LE sampled values and GOOSE, is only supported on the Network 1 interface. The
parameters for setting the secondary IP network are located under Configuration/
Communication/Ethernet/Network 2 address.

The IP address for Network 2 is disabled by default settings, and all Ethernet ports are
assigned to the same IP address used in the Network 1 address menu Configuration/
Communication/Ethernet/Network 1. If Network 2 is taken into use by the setting
Enable="True" (requires reboot), the interlink port X3 of the COM module is assigned
to this second network, using the IP address and subnet parameters in the Network 2
address menu Configuration/Communication/Ethernet/Network 2 address.
If the Network 2 interface is enabled, PTP time synchronization and
SMV/GOOSE multicast are disabled for that port.
